Dexterity develops Physical AI systems that give industrial robots human-like dexterity for complex logistics tasks. Founded in 2017 and headquartered in Redwood City, California, the company is led by CEO Samir Menon and focuses on deploying real-world autonomous solutions rather than laboratory demonstrations. Its technology enables robots to perceive, reason, and act in unstructured environments, handling edge cases that typically defeat conventional automation.
The company’s core offering is a fleet of AI agents that work together to control robotic arms and mobile platforms. These agents run the Foresight world model, a large-scale Physical AI system trained on more than 100 million real-world autonomous actions. Foresight allows robots to understand physical dynamics, plan sequences, and make decisions in under 400 milliseconds while maintaining a perfect safety record.
Dexterity’s primary robot-based product is its autonomous truck-loading solution, which uses high-payload robotic arms to load and unload trailers in live distribution centers. The system handles mixed pallets, irregular packages, and dynamic conditions without human intervention. Additional deployments include fully autonomous piece picking and depalletizing for parcel and 3PL operations. All solutions are designed for continuous production use and integrate with existing warehouse infrastructure.
Major customers include FedEx, Sagawa Express, Sumitomo Corporation, and Mech. These deployments have driven over 100 million autonomous actions across multiple countries, with zero safety incidents. Dexterity positions its technology as ready for immediate enterprise adoption, not future pilots.
